Yes, it should be fine (although I am not a dog nutritionist). For some dogs Papaya can actually help digestive issues and is high in vitamins and minerals. I suggest feeding only a small amount and don't feed the dog fruit within two hours of eating normal meat! One website says

'A good source of vitamins A, C, and E; calcium, phosphorus, and iron. Papaya is said to be a good source of digestive properties to soothe the stomach. I like to buy dehydrated papaya and feed it to my dogs. It is like candy to them!'

But, remember Papaya is high in sugar- so yes it is like 'candy' to them- only feed it as a treat! Hope this helped, if after feeding your Pug papaya make sure they seemsokay- if anything out of the usual occurs, contact your vet!
